Congress units across the country and the region observed the occasion as Vishwasghat Diwas, slamming the BJP-led government at the centre for not fulfilling its promises.
The Arunachal Pradesh Congress Committee staged a rally in Itanagar highlighting the BJP led government’s alleged failure in bringing about development.
Members of the Tripura Pradesh Congress Committee too staged protest in Agartala slamming the BJP-led government at the centre for allegedly betraying the common people. Meanwhile, Congress in Manipur also staged protest.
